Output 9020d96d717154a985a273d28e9fbfd13b5b377f9e43b912f85260e659c59d57:7

value
27943756
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80c6269ada0513a900931c5eb4cd65b2e64b0c6d OP_EQUAL
address
MKe46k5EeGz2Z3zD6FoocFUavPpMqTsKTp
transaction
9020d96d717154a985a273d28e9fbfd13b5b377f9e43b912f85260e659c59d57
spent
true